Founded in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been dedicated to reducing the time to market for innovators creating new medical devices. The company stands out by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times ranging from 1 to 3 days—an achievement unattainable with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ard recognized the vital need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for rapid development programs engineering inn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is paramount in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old considerable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Moreover rout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. The Importance of Medical Device Sterilization

Infection prevention remains a core component of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Appropriate sterilization of medical devices greatly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ers concurrently. Deficient sterilization can cause outbreaks of critical di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Methods of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has advanced significantly over the last century, employing a variety of methods suited to numerous types of devices and materials. Some of the most regularly applied techniques include:

Sterilization Using Autoclaves

Autoclaving remains the most popular and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is quick, cost-effective, and environmentally safe,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

As sterilization practices progresses, several key trends are influencing medical sterilization methods:

Sustainable Sterilization Practices

As eco-friendly mandates tighten, organizations are increasingly exploring environmentally conscious sterilization solutions. Strategies include lowering reliance on unsafe ch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ring eco-friendly packaging choices, and optimizing utility use in sterilization practices.

High-tech Materials and Device Complexity

The increase of advanced med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ization processes capable of handling elaborate materials. Innovations in sterilization include methods for example low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ging complex components.

Automated Sterilization Tracking

With advances in digital technology, tracking of sterilization activities is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er in-depth docum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time alerts, significantly reducing human error and raising patient safety.
